Re:discovered Sunken Timber

Re:discovered is a collection of rare timber recovered from submerged forests around the world, in partnership with Triton. Preserved underwater for decades, sometimes centuries, each piece carries a character that simply cannot be replicated. Recovered using patented underwater technology without felling living trees, it brings extraordinary provenance and a remarkably consistent supply to flooring, furniture and bespoke joinery.

Reclaimed timber, shaped by its past

Recovered from submerged forests, Re:discovered timber carries grain, markings and irregularities shaped by decades — sometimes centuries — underwater. Rather than removing them, we work with these characteristics, allowing the material’s history to remain visible in every application.

From flooring to furniture, joinery and beyond

Re:discovered is a material without a prescribed outcome. It can become bespoke flooring, furniture and architectural joinery, handcrafted in our Cheshire workshop or co-created around the needs of a project. We can also supply the timber directly to architects, designers and makers, leaving what it becomes entirely open.
